flag Texas Instruments reports strong Q1, beats EPS, sees positive Q2 outlook, boosting stock.

flag Texas Instruments reported strong Q1 results, slightly missing revenue targets but beating EPS expectations, leading to a 5% stock increase in after-hours trading. flag The company's Q2 projections also exceeded analyst forecasts, suggesting continued positive performance. flag Despite a slight reduction in shares owned by Sompo Asset Management, Texas Instruments' outlook is optimistic, bolstered by robust earnings and a steady dividend payout.
